I apologize in advance if this is the wrong place to ask, but can anyone on this board confirm to have seen or own a non-hacked Pokemon with straight 31's for their IV's? According to Peterko and X-Act's Breeding Guide, the chance of this is very roughly 1 in a million. It seems possible that someone on this board might have one, so I'm just curious if this has happened.
 
I recall that Jumpman, known for his patience with breeding, attempted to get a flawless Magikarp, known for quickly hatching, and after roughly 180 thousand eggs (or so the legend goes), he was unable to get 31/31/31/31/31/31.

I've also hatched thousands of eggs in my time and my all time best stands at 30/30/28/31/31/31. If I ever do see a totally flawless Pokemon, I don't imagine I'd waste any time in shouting hack.

The problem with having a perfect pokemon is that you're better off not telling anyone because they will automatically assume that you're a hacker. Also, to be honest with you, it isn't all that important to have perfect IVs since the majority of pokemon don't use them all. What does my Jolteon want to do with its 31 atk IV, for instance?
